About This Home
Spacious 4 bedroom, 2 full bathroom ranch plan home in desirable Countryside neighborhood. Landscaped front yard with ample parking, and large 2 car attached garage. As you enter, the main level offers an open and bright floor plan with ceramic tile floors throughout. The living room features a gas fireplace and opens to the dining and kitchen areas. Sliding glass doors walk out to the patio and large fenced back yard. Also on this level, is the first of two possible primary bedrooms with adjoining full bath and walk-in closet. There are 2 additional bedrooms on the main. The basement has a large family room, the second possible primary or 4th bedroom, a spacious full bath with separate soaker tub and stand-up shower, and a laundry area with extra storage space. This home offers over 2,000 square feet, main level living, Central A/C, radon mitigation system, and is conveniently located close to schools, parks, shopping, restaurants, Fort Carson and easy access to I-25. A prospective tenant has the right to provide to the landlord a portable tenant screening report, as defined in section 38-12-902(2.5), Colorado Revised Statutes; and 2. If a prospective tenant provides the landlord with a portable tenant screening report, the landlord is prohibited from: Charging the prospective tenant, a rental application fee; or Charging the prospective tenant, a fee for the landlord to access or use the portable tenant screening report.

With the cityscape on one side and open countryside on the other, the small city of Fountain is a suburban community located fifteen miles down Interstate 25 from Downtown Colorado Springs. Living in Fountain allows you to take full advantage of Colorado’s gorgeous natural landscape: Pike’s Peak is within view, with the nearby Front Range providing both beautiful scenery and endless opportunities for hiking, camping, biking, and skiing.
Closer to home, the lush Fountain Creek Regional Park features a network of paths and trails that you can access without even leaving town. The city is also home to Pike’s Peak International Raceway, which hosts all manner of auto racing and other events throughout the year.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
